Question

If the sum of three consecutive integers is 9, what are the integers?

Solution

Find the consecutive integers:

Consider that the consecutive integers are x,x+1 and x+2.
We know that the sum of three consecutive integers is 9.
x+x+1+x+2=93x+3=93x=9-33x=6x=6×13x=2
Substitute the value of x=2 in the consecutive integers x,x+1 and x+2.
The values of consecutive integers are2,3 and 4.

Therefore, the required consecutive integers are2,3 and 4.
